Availability

Peugeot remote keys and key fobs employ a unique system of immobilisation to prevent them being copied. These systems are based on a small glass chip inside the key that communicates with the vehicle's immobiliser. The chip is unique in code that cannot be altered or removed, and will only allow the car to start when it receives the proper signal from the key. If the chip isn't correctly placed, the engine will not start and will cut off its fuel supply.

The factory-installed immobilisers from Peugeot have been upgraded since 1995 to guarantee the safety of your vehicle. Each key contains a tiny glass chip hidden within the key's head and is programmed with an individual code that cannot be erased or overwritten. The chip is synced with the Peugeot immobiliser and the system will allow the engine to only start when it receives a proper signal.

The transponder chip in Peugeot car keys functions in sync with the car's immobiliser. The chip is concealed within the head of the manual key or remote locking key. It transmits a code to the car's system when inserted into the lock barrel. The immobiliser checks if the code is correct and allows the engine to start. If the chip isn't present or has a different code, the fuel supply will be shut off.

Another way to safeguard your Peugeot key fob is to make use of a faraday pouch which blocks the signal and protects it from thieves. They are available at hardware stores, as well as big-box retailers, but they're also available online. Some people place their keys inside the tin to secure them.
